Abstract

The invention provides Chinese herbal medicine additive for improving meat quality of java tilapia, containing by weight of: 22-30% of spatholobus stem, 30-40% of black bean, 10-15% of glycyrrhiza, 5-10% of honeysuckle, 5-10% of radix isatidis and 10-15% of hawthorn. The advantages of the invention comprise: (1) having good phagostimulant effect, (2) substantially reducing fat content and cholesterol level in muscles of java tilapia, substantially increasing flavor substance content of inosinic acid in muscles, improving muscles quality of java tilapia, (3), adding and using conveniently, and directly adding in commercial feedstuff, wherein the components can generates synergistic effect with other additive components in commercial feedstuff, and raise weighting rate and disease resistance of java tilapia, and (4) having stabile raw material resource, low price, simple production process and easy for industrialization production.

[0001] The invention relates to a feed additive, in particular to a Chinese herbal medicine additive for improving the meat quality of tilapia. Background technique

[0002] Commonly known as African crucian carp and white salmon, tilapia is a cultured species recommended by the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ations to the world. The intensive farming of tilapia is one of the pillars of the "one fish, one shrimp" industrial chain in Guangdong Province. However, with the improvement of the degree of intensification and the popularization of the use of compound feed, the growth rate of tilapia has increased compared with the past, but the flavor of the fish meat has shown a downward trend.
